Power Infrastructure Reality in Iraq

Analyzing the critical demand for reliable backup power in the Middle East region.

Iraq faces a unique set of challenges characterized by a significant gap between electricity demand and national grid supply. The prevalence of frequent outages makes the cummins generator a gold standard for reliability in Baghdad and Basra, where businesses cannot afford a single minute of downtime.

The geographical environment plays a decisive role; extreme summer temperatures often exceeding 50°C require specialized cooling systems. This is why the silent diesel generator is increasingly popular in urban residential areas, combining noise reduction with high-efficiency thermal management to operate sustainably under heat stress.

From an economic perspective, the reconstruction of oil fields and industrial zones has spiked the demand for high-capacity units. The adoption of the weichai diesel generator has provided a cost-effective yet powerful alternative for construction sites and manufacturing plants across the country.

Market Development History

In the early 2000s, the Iraqi market relied heavily on refurbished mechanical generators with minimal control systems, focusing purely on raw power output to survive basic outages.

Between 2010 and 2020, there was a shift toward digitalization. The introduction of the yuchai diesel generator brought advanced electronic governors and better fuel efficiency, aligning with the growing industrialization of the region.

Currently, the focus has shifted to "Smart Power." Integration of Automatic Transfer Switches (ATS) and remote monitoring has become standard, allowing Iraqi facility managers to synchronize multiple units for seamless load sharing.

Thermal Optimization
Development of oversized radiators and high-ambient temperature cooling kits specifically for the 50°C+ Iraqi climate.
Fuel Versatility
Engineering engines to maintain high performance despite varying qualities of local diesel fuel available in Iraq.
Noise Mitigation
Advancements in acoustic enclosure materials to reduce urban noise pollution in densely populated Iraqi cities.
Grid Synchronization
Smart controllers allowing generators to blend seamlessly with the Iraqi national grid to stabilize voltage fluctuations.

How to choose the right capacity for an industrial diesel generator in Iraq?

You must calculate the total peak load and add a 20-30% safety margin. In Iraq, we recommend oversizing slightly to account for efficiency drops during extreme summer heat.

Can a silent diesel generator operate effectively in 50°C weather?

Yes, provided it is equipped with a tropical-grade radiator and enhanced ventilation. Our silent series uses high-airflow enclosures to prevent overheating.

What are the maintenance intervals for a cummins generator in dusty environments?

Due to the high dust levels in Iraq, we recommend checking air filters every 250 hours and performing a full service every 500 hours to ensure engine longevity.

Is the weichai diesel generator compatible with local Iraqi fuel?

Yes, Weichai engines are designed for robustness. We suggest installing an additional fuel-water separator to protect the injectors from impurities.
